BURSA MALAYSIA –
The Group recorded a profit before taxation of RM10.2 million for the quarter under review compared to a profit before tax of RM10.5 million in the preceding quarter. It is partly due to the slower new enrolments due to Movement Control Order (MCO) and border control arising from the effects of the Covid-19 pandemic.
REMUNERATION STUDY –
In Financial Year End 2019, the directors’ remuneration was 1.15 million. It was low compared to average in listed companies, considering the employees’ remuneration of 103 million and auditor’s remuneration of 411 thousands
